1. Cheese Pairings
Cheese and wine go hand in hand, and White Zinfandel is no exception. The light and fruity nature of White Zinfandel can complement a variety of cheeses, particularly those that are mild and slightly creamy. Here are a few cheese pairings that work wonderfully with White Zinfandel:
Brie
Brie is a soft, creamy cheese that pairs beautifully with the fruity, slightly sweet notes of White Zinfandel. The richness of the brie enhances the wine’s smooth texture, while the wine’s acidity cuts through the creaminess, providing a balanced and delightful tasting experience. Serve Brie with crackers or fresh baguette slices for a perfect appetizer pairing.
Goat Cheese
Goat cheese, with its tangy flavor and crumbly texture, is another excellent option to pair with White Zinfandel. The acidity and citrus notes in the wine help to balance the tanginess of the goat cheese, creating a harmonious combination. Pair it with fresh herbs or drizzle some honey on top for a unique and delicious flavor profile.
Havarti
Havarti is a mild, semi-soft cheese that has a smooth, buttery flavor. It pairs well with White Zinfandel because it doesn’t overpower the wine’s subtle fruitiness. The wine’s sweetness and acidity complement the creamy texture of Havarti, creating a perfect balance of flavors. Try serving it with fruit slices or crackers for a delightful cheese board.
2. Appetizers and Snacks
When it comes to appetizers and snacks, White Zinfandel shines. Its light, fruity profile is a great match for a wide range of savory and slightly sweet starters. Whether you’re hosting a cocktail party or having a casual meal, these appetizers and snacks will pair beautifully with White Zinfandel:
Shrimp Cocktail
A classic shrimp cocktail is a fantastic pairing for White Zinfandel. The light, delicate flavors of shrimp work well with the crisp acidity of the wine, while the slight sweetness in the wine complements the tangy cocktail sauce. This pairing is a refreshing and sophisticated choice for any gathering.
Caprese Salad
A Caprese salad, made with fresh tomatoes, mozzarella, basil, and a drizzle of balsamic glaze, is a delightful dish to serve with White Zinfandel. The tangy sweetness of the balsamic glaze pairs beautifully with the fruity notes in the wine, while the freshness of the tomatoes and mozzarella enhances the light and refreshing qualities of the wine.
Bruschetta
Bruschetta, topped with fresh tomatoes, basil, garlic, and a drizzle of olive oil, is another perfect appetizer to enjoy with White Zinfandel. The acidity in the wine balances the tomatoes’ juiciness, while the wine’s crispness pairs well with the fresh, vibrant flavors of the dish.
Chicken Skewers
Grilled chicken skewers, whether they’re marinated with herbs or glazed with a sweet sauce, are a great choice for pairing with White Zinfandel. The wine’s slight sweetness pairs well with the savory grilled chicken, and the acidity helps to cut through any richness from the marinade or sauce. Add a side of grilled vegetables for an extra touch of flavor.
3. Salads and Fresh Dishes
White Zinfandel’s crisp, refreshing nature makes it an ideal match for salads and light, fresh dishes. The wine’s acidity pairs well with the crispness of leafy greens and the tanginess of vinaigrettes. Here are some of the best salads and fresh dishes to enjoy with White Zinfandel:
Mixed Green Salad with Balsamic Vinaigrette
A simple mixed green salad dressed with balsamic vinaigrette is a great dish to pair with White Zinfandel. The crisp acidity of the wine complements the tangy vinaigrette, while the wine’s slight sweetness balances the bitterness of the greens. Add some goat cheese or nuts for extra texture and flavor.
Grilled Chicken Salad
A grilled chicken salad with fresh vegetables, nuts, and a light vinaigrette dressing is another excellent pairing for White Zinfandel. The light, lean protein of the chicken works perfectly with the wine’s refreshing fruitiness, and the vegetables add a crisp texture that enhances the wine’s crispness.
Ceviche
Ceviche, made with fresh fish or shrimp marinated in citrus juice, is a bright and zesty dish that pairs wonderfully with White Zinfandel. The wine’s acidity complements the citrus notes in the ceviche, while its sweetness balances the dish’s bold flavors. It’s a perfect pairing for a summer day.
4. Pasta Dishes
Pasta dishes, particularly those that feature light sauces, are an excellent choice to enjoy with White Zinfandel. The wine’s refreshing nature and fruit-forward profile make it an ideal match for pasta dishes that aren’t too rich or creamy. Here are some pasta dishes that go well with White Zinfandel:
Pasta Primavera
Pasta primavera, made with fresh vegetables and a light olive oil or white wine sauce, is a great option to serve with White Zinfandel. The wine’s crisp acidity complements the freshness of the vegetables, while its fruity notes enhance the delicate flavors of the dish.
Pasta with Tomato Sauce
A simple pasta with a tomato-based sauce, such as spaghetti marinara, pairs well with White Zinfandel. The acidity of the wine helps to balance the tanginess of the tomato sauce, while the fruitiness of the wine complements the rich, savory flavors of the dish.
Lemon Garlic Pasta
A lemon garlic pasta dish is a fantastic choice for White Zinfandel. The bright citrus flavors in the pasta are enhanced by the wine’s acidity, while the garlic adds a savory richness that complements the wine’s sweetness. This pairing is light yet flavorful and perfect for a casual dinner.
5. Main Courses
White Zinfandel can also be paired with a variety of main courses. While it’s not typically suited for heavy, rich meats, it pairs beautifully with lighter meats, seafood, and even some pork dishes. Here are some main courses that pair well with White Zinfandel:
Grilled Salmon
Grilled salmon, with its rich, oily texture and slightly smoky flavor, is a fantastic main course to pair with White Zinfandel. The wine’s crisp acidity helps to cut through the richness of the fish, while the fruity notes of the wine enhance the flavor of the salmon. Add a side of roasted vegetables or a citrusy salad for a complete meal.
Grilled Pork Chops
Grilled pork chops, particularly those that are marinated with a slightly sweet glaze, work well with White Zinfandel. The wine’s sweetness complements the natural sweetness of the pork, while its acidity helps to balance the richness of the meat. Pair it with mashed potatoes or roasted root vegetables for a hearty meal.
Turkey with Cranberry Sauce
White Zinfandel is an excellent choice to pair with turkey, especially when served with cranberry sauce. The wine’s fruity profile complements the sweetness of the cranberries, while its acidity pairs well with the savory flavors of the turkey. This pairing is perfect for a festive meal, such as Thanksgiving or a holiday dinner.
6. Desserts
White Zinfandel’s slight sweetness makes it an ideal wine to enjoy with dessert. Whether you prefer fruit-based sweets or creamy treats, there’s a White Zinfandel pairing to suit your taste. Here are some desserts that go beautifully with White Zinfandel:
Fruit Tart
A fruit tart with a crisp, buttery crust and a fresh fruit topping is a delightful dessert to pair with White Zinfandel. The wine’s sweetness enhances the natural sweetness of the fruit, while its acidity helps to balance the richness of the tart’s custard filling.
Cheesecake with Berry Compote
Cheesecake, particularly when topped with a fresh berry compote, pairs wonderfully with White Zinfandel. The richness of the cheesecake is complemented by the wine’s light, refreshing profile, while the berry compote adds a touch of sweetness that matches the wine’s fruity notes.
Chocolate-Covered Strawberries
Chocolate-covered strawberries are a classic dessert that pairs beautifully with White Zinfandel. The sweetness of the strawberries and the richness of the chocolate are balanced by the wine’s fruity and slightly sweet flavor, creating a decadent yet refreshing pairing.
